The Enigmatic Allure of a Modern Creation

Let’s start with the question that is likely at the forefront of your mind: where does Haisley come from? Unlike names like Elizabeth or Alexander, whose roots are buried deep in the soil of history and ancient languages, Haisley is a child of our modern era. It’s what name experts call a coinage or a neologism—a newly created name that has blossomed in popularity primarily in the 21st century.

This lack of ancient, dusty lineage isn’t a weakness; it’s Haisley’s superpower. It means the name is unburdened by centuries of expectation and precedent. It arrives fresh, a blank canvas upon which your daughter can paint the story of her life. Most onomastic scholars (those who study names) trace Haisley’s sound and style to the trend of surnames-as-first-names and the creation of new names ending in the ubiquitous and charming “-ley” or “-lee” sound. This suffix, of Old English origin meaning “meadow” or “clearing,” imparts a sense of openness, peace, and natural beauty. Think of names like Ashley, Paisley, Kinsley, and Finley—Haisley fits perfectly within this melodic and popular cohort.

But while it shares a phonetic neighborhood with these names, Haisley carves out its own distinct identity. The first syllable, “Hais,” is the true mystery. It doesn’t have a fixed meaning, which allows for a delightful sense of interpretation. Does it sound like “haze,” evoking a soft, dreamy morning landscape? Or does it connect to the sturdy, occupational English surname “Hayes,” implying one who lived near a hedged enclosure? This very ambiguity is the source of its charm. Haisley can be whatever you feel it to be: a dreamy meadow, a protected garden, a completely new and unique creation for a new and unique individual.

A Meteoric Ascent: How Haisley Captured the Modern Imagination

To truly appreciate the impact of Haisley, we need to look at the numbers. Its story is one of the most dramatic and fascinating tales in modern onomastics. At the turn of the millennium, Haisley was virtually absent from the Social Security Administration’s list of the top 1,000 baby names in the United States. It was a hidden gem, waiting to be discovered.

Then, something shifted. Around 2010, Haisley began its quiet entrance. And once it started, its climb was nothing short of spectacular. It broke into the Top 1000 and then began a relentless ascent up the charts, gaining dozens of spots year after year. As of the most recent data, Haisley has confidently secured a position well within the Top 200 most popular names for baby girls in the U.S., and its trajectory shows no signs of slowing down. This isn’t just a minor bump in popularity; it’s a cultural takeover.

So, what fueled this incredible rise? The answer lies in a perfect storm of cultural trends. First, the ongoing love affair with “-ley” ending names provided a comfortable and familiar landing pad for parents’ ears. Second, there’s the modern preference for unique-yet-accessible names. Parents today are increasingly seeking names that will allow their children to stand out in a crowd without being overly complicated or difficult to pronounce. Haisley, with its simple, two-syllable structure and intuitive spelling, fits this bill perfectly.

Furthermore, the digital age has played a crucial role. As parents began using online name forums and databases, names like Haisley that were once regional or obscure found a national and even global audience. It’s a name that looks beautiful in an Instagram bio and sounds gentle and strong when called across a playground. Its rise is a testament to its inherent wearability—it’s a name that works for a baby, a professional woman, and everyone in between.

Haisley in the Wild: Middle Names, Sibling Sets, and Stylistic Pairings

A name never exists in a vacuum. It’s part of a larger ecosystem that includes a surname, potential middle names, and the names of siblings. The wonderful news is that Haisley’s versatility makes it a dream to style.

When it comes to middle names, Haisley provides a fantastic, melodic foundation. You can choose to lean into its modern feel with a chic, one-syllable name, or you can ground it with a timeless classic.

  • For a modern, crisp combination: Haisley Wren, Haisley Sage, Haisley Blake, Haisley Quinn.
  • To complement its sweetness: Haisley June, Haisley Mae, Haisley Pearl, Haisley Faye.
  • To add a touch of classic elegance: Haisley Grace, Haisley Charlotte, Haisley Eleanor, Haisley Katherine.
  • For a truly unique, bohemian flair: Haisley Juniper, Haisley Willow, Haisley Aurora, Haisley Seraphina.

Building a sibling set around Haisley is equally enjoyable. The goal is to find names that share a similar modern-yet-eternal vibe without being too matchy.

  • For a sister: You might consider names like Everly, Paisley, Kinsley, Hadley, Rowan, Isla, or Harper.
  • For a brother: Names like Hudson, Sawyer, Grayson, Finn, Asher, Beckett, or Miles would create a harmonious and stylish sibset.

The key is to find a flow that feels natural to you. Say the names out loud together. Do they tell a story you love? Haisley is such a adaptable and charming anchor that it makes building this family narrative a joy.
